### Step 4: Update your plugin's assignment client

Splitframe v3 replaces synchronous assignment calls with a cached evaluation model. Your plugin must now fetch the experiment manifest at startup and refresh it on the interval specified by the service, rather than calling the assignment endpoint per user. Bucketing remains deterministic, so existing assignments are preserved across the migration. Before updating your client, verify your test environment matches the reference configuration shown below.

config for kagup-hahig:
druwyn:
  pin: 2801
  metrics_host: metrics.druwyn.zemvarlabs.internal
  tenant: sorius
  seal: seal_798a43d7

Handover — encoding detection service

Taking over Charset sniffing on the Lintrose upload path? Short version: detection falls back to a byte-frequency model when BOM checks fail, and mislabeled legacy files get quarantined rather than re-encoded. Nothing is on fire; one flaky test in the Cyrillic suite. The service currently runs with the following configuration.

service settings:
[pelius]
port = 5432
team = praius
host = pelius.crelvoforge.internal
region = upper-4
access_code = ac_8f224d
timeout_ms = 2000

**Deploy step 4 — report exports, timezones**

Quick heads-up from this week's Lumenreef rollout: report exports now render timestamps in the workspace timezone instead of UTC, so the scheduler pod needs the tzdata sidecar enabled before you ship. If you skip it, exports silently fall back to UTC and finance will notice by Tuesday. Flip `EXPORT_TZ_MODE=workspace` in the env file, redeploy the exporter, and spot-check one PDF. Right after that flag, add the exporter's signing secret on the next line.

vault entry, yahif-yajep: COURIER_KEY29=b802bdf8034096b65a51c6ba5abe2

Item 7: Health checks behind the load balancer. For every service pool fronted by the Skerrit balancer, confirm that the health endpoint verifies real dependencies (database reachability, cache warm state) rather than returning a static 200. Check that failure thresholds drain traffic within 30 seconds and that checks run on the same port as production traffic. Record any pools using legacy TCP-only probes as findings. Questions on this item should go to the owner listed below.

signatory, kaweg-fawig: Zorys Druys Jorius Novael